(+)-pulegone is a lipid of Prenol Lipids (PR) class. The involved functions are known as Excretory function, conjugation, Competitive inhibition, radiochemical and Synthesis. (+)-pulegone often locates in Microsomes. The associated genes with (+)-Pulegone are 4S-limonene synthase.
